3 Seconds Of Air have been working towards their debut album for almost a decade. Originally the still nameless project was an exploratory vessel for guitar-duo Dirk Serries and Paul Van Den Berg's forrays into unknown territories. The early years were marked by a dialogue between their individual styles, Van Den Berg contributing his blues influences and Serries building on his experience in the field of ambient and drones. With the inclusion of bassist Martina Verhoeven, however, their sound started to change, picking up further depth, resonance and direction. pieces became more epic and complex, Verhoeven's minimal bass opening up bridges to an ethereal take on doom, a slow-motion version of minimal music and the psychedelic experiments of the late 60s and early 70s.



In February of this year, the trio finally felt their musical communication had reached a new level of intuition and proficiency. The Flight Of Song was recorded on two frosty days in the snow-covered Belgian chapel of Sint-Theobaldus. Hot coffee would come to the rescue as a small electric stove proved too noisey to be kept running during the actual recording sessions. On the other hand, the extreme conditions and the breathtaking beauty of the chapel were vital in terms of creating the devastating sensation of sheer majesty and weightless drift the band were looking for: in the end, the entire album was recorded on the spot, with all improvisations captured by a single stereo microphone connected to a laptop.

When Fear Falls Burning played anonymously as a member of Grey Daturas during their concert at the ZXZW festival in The Netherlands in 2007, something clicked. The Black Fire is the result of the bonding between Black Widow (Robert MacManus of Grey Daturas) and Fear Falls Burning, an album full of fuzzy, spiraling and feedback-ish drones. Limited to 300 copies on 170gram black vinyl and released by Robert's own Heathenskull label.

N - Bergen : Skizzen + Notizen (LP): On this LP Hellmut Neidhardt works together with Fear Falls Burning, Mirko Uhlig and Segment to realize this album of remixes, recyclings and additional performances, based upon N's magnificent Bergen 2LP. Fear Falls Burning recycles one of N's amplified drones while adding his trademark guitar drones to re-create the song. Expected for a release in July/August on the Belgian Consouling Sounds label. Limited to 220 copies on 180 gram vinyl.

Year Of No Light - Live At Roadburn 2008 (LP/DVD): This live album features on side 2 the live registration of Year Of No Light's clash with Fear Falls Burning at Roadburn 2008. Immensely appreciated by the audience, this is a live improvisation between the French band and Fear Falls Burning that balances beautifully between post-rock and drone music. Now available on Roadburn Records in 3 different versions: gold in a silkscreened cover, silver and black vinyl.

Dirk Serries - Microphonics VII (LP): Part two in Dirk Serries' microphonics live series on limited one-sided vinyl for Tonefloat, Microphonics VII is the registration of the performance at the first Antwerp Looping Festival in May 2009. This is most likely the best example on how harmonic, minimal and meditative microphonics can actually get. Microphonics VII will be published on September 22nd, 2009 as a one-sided album on Tonefloat. Pressed in a limited edition of one hundred copies each on gold, silver and white vinyl.
